Назад
Company hidden
1 день назад

Lead Software Developer (Cryptography)

118 000 - 168 000CAD
Формат работы
onsite
Тип работы
fulltime
Грейд
lead
Английский
b2
Страна
Canada
Вакансия из списка Hirify.GlobalВакансия из Hirify Global, списка международных tech-компаний
Для мэтча и отклика нужен Plus

Мэтч & Сопровод

Для мэтча с этой вакансией нужен Plus

Описание вакансии

Текст:
/

TL;DR

Lead Software Developer (Cryptography): Building and optimizing a data-centric encryption platform with an accent on cross-platform C/C++ libraries and multi-language SDKs. Focus on implementing symmetric and asymmetric encryption, key management, and ensuring platform security across Linux, Windows, and mainframe environments.

Location: Office-based in Richmond Hill, Mississauga, Ottawa, or Waterloo, ON, Canada

Salary: $118,000 - $168,000 CAD

Company

hirify.global is a global leader in information management specializing in AI-driven digital transformation and data-centric security.

What you will do

  • Lead feature development from design through implementation and release for the Voltage SecureData platform.
  • Develop and review cryptographic functionality, including encryption, key management, and TLS configuration.
  • Maintain and optimize Java and C# SDK layers and their native interoperability with the core C library.
  • Set standards for code quality and drive CI/CD strategies using CMake, GitLab CI, and Jenkins.
  • Mentor engineers and provide technical leadership on architectural decisions.
  • Act as an escalation point for cryptographic, HSM, and PKCS#11 related defects.

Requirements

  • Expert-level proficiency in C/C++, C#, and Java.
  • Strong background in systems programming across Linux, Windows, or UNIX-like platforms.
  • Practical applied cryptography experience (TLS/SSL, public-key, symmetric encryption, and key management).
  • Experience designing cross-language SDKs and native interop.
  • Strong skills in build engineering with CMake and CI/CD pipelines.
  • Must be based in or able to work from the specified Ontario locations (Office-based)

Nice to have

  • Experience with PKCS#11 and HSM integration (nCipher, Atalla, Thales Luna).
  • Knowledge of post-quantum cryptography and payment standards (EMV, PCI-DSS, ISO 8583).
  • IBM z/OS or HPE NonStop development experience.
  • Proficiency using AI-assisted development tools in production environments.

Culture & Benefits

  • Ownership of security-critical systems used by major global enterprises.
  • Exposure to rare platforms such as IBM z/OS and HPE NonStop.
  • Comprehensive benefits package supporting physical, emotional, and financial wellbeing.
  • Engineering-driven culture focused on technical quality and real-world problem solving.
  • Vacation entitlement and paid time off.

Будьте осторожны: если работодатель просит войти в их систему, используя iCloud/Google, прислать код/пароль, запустить код/ПО, не делайте этого - это мошенники. Обязательно жмите "Пожаловаться" или пишите в поддержку. Подробнее в гайде →